Address 0 PPC

PTATs87RD5HUdYRtdHM32aALx9wBeouy6V

Confirmed

Total Received63.086237 PPC
Total Sent63.086237 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PTATs87RD5HUdYRtdHM32aALx9wBeouy6V63.086237 PPC
Fee: 0.01 PPC
664627 Confirmations63.076237 PPC
PTATs87RD5HUdYRtdHM32aALx9wBeouy6V63.086237 PPC
PDARimvRRyPts8zJ9YwMvDsy68AxFabiTB1.185636 PPC
Fee: 0.01 PPC
664643 Confirmations64.271873 PPC